Overview

Los Mariachis, nestled in the heart of Las Cruces, New Mexico, serves as a vibrant gateway into authentic Mexican cuisine. Located conveniently on N Motel Blvd, this restaurant offers an inviting ambiance marked by bright, welcoming decor that complements the rich flavors found within their menu. Whether you're stopping by for lunch or dinner, Los Mariachis presents an array of dishes crafted to satisfy a variety of tastes, blending tradition with generous portions.

Their menu is proudly anchored by classics such as the Enchilada Plate and Beef Taco Plate, both embodying the essence of Mexican comfort food through well-balanced sauces and fresh ingredients. The Gordita Combos, including the festive Gordita Combo Christmas, showcase the kitchen’s skill in layering flavors and textures, delivering a satisfying and hearty experience. For a unique twist on breakfast, the Old Mesilla Omelette stands out, catering to those who appreciate a savory start steeped in local culinary influences.

Los Mariachis excels in offering dishes like Carne Asada Fries and Chilaquiles, which highlight their mastery of traditional Mexican preparation with a touch of regional flair. The Burrito Bañado Plate, accompanied by an option of red or green chile, reflects the boldness many patrons seek in Mexican fare. Attention to detail extends to their sides, from chile rellenos to fresh pico de gallo, allowing each meal to be customized to one’s palate.

I went here in mid afternoon after doing some business across the street at the County Building. I had heard for some time that the food was really good here. My visit lived up to that claim. I had the flautas special. I don't really care for flautas because they're hard with almost no filling. But the waitress enthusiastically told me that theirs were different. They were. Round with just the right degree of hardness on the outside and meaty inside, it was a delicious, filling and reasonably priced meal. The service was excellent. The atmosphere was pleasant if somewhat plain. I definitely look forward to eating here again! UPDATE: Went to this restaurant again today for Taco Tuesday. The friend I went with had tacos and I had the gordita plate. She loved the tacos! The gorditos were crisp and filling. This restaurant always gives generous servings. Both of us took food home. This restaurant just seems to get better every time I go! There was one new thing that I hadn't encountered before: one price if you pay by card and a lower price if you pay by cash. The difference was somewhere around $1.50. I paid by cash.
